That black tank is NOT a ST tank….. it’s a paralever GS, or r100/80r tank. ( the r100r tanks don’t have the seat loop on the back end,)

As ST tank looks like a g/s tank, but different filler cap.

Personally,I wouldn’t powder a tank,although very tough it’s a plastic,and will not polish up,any attempt to polish it will actually make it dull.
A bit like plastic mudguards.
Unless your powder man can do some form of lacquer over the top of the powder?
